Naturals Salon

Locate the nearest store(s)

Search Nearby
Advanced Search

Naturals Salon stores In Moulivakkam, Chennai, Tamil Nadu

No 5/214, Kundrathur Main Rd, Rajiv Gandhi Nagar
Moulivakkam
Chennai - 600116
Open until 09:00 PM